The FN P90, or FN Project 1990, is a highly regarded personal defense weapon (PDW) crafted by FN Herstal in Belgium. Designed to meet NATO’s demand for a next-generation replacement for conventional 9×19mm firearms, the P90 provides a compact yet formidable option for vehicle crews, special forces, and counter-terrorism units.
With a bullpup configuration that significantly shortens its overall length while maintaining a full-length barrel, the P90 features an integrated reflex sight and fully ambidextrous controls, ensuring versatility for all users. Its innovative top-mounted magazine holds the unique 5.7×28mm ammunition known for its high-velocity and low-recoil properties, making it ideal for rapid engagements.
The P90’s futuristic design includes options for visible or infrared lasers and tritium lights, enhancing its utility in various operational circumstances. Currently deployed by military and law enforcement agencies in over 40 countries, including the United States, the FN P90 is not just a PDW; its capabilities allow it to double as a compact assault rifle or submachine gun, ensuring its place as a sought-after firearm for professionals. A civilian version, the semi-automatic PS90, has been available since 2005, making this cutting-edge weapon accessible to firearm enthusiasts.
